1. Typical Measurements
Typical measurements form the foundation of any antler scoring system. These measurements, taken with specialized tools, quantify key antler characteristics, providing the raw data for score calculation. A precise understanding of these measurements is essential for accurate scoring and meaningful comparisons. The primary measurements typically include the length of the main beam, the circumference of the main beam at various points, the length of tines, and the inside spread of the antlers. The relationship between these measurements and the final score varies depending on the specific scoring system used, but the underlying principle remains consistent: larger and more symmetrical antlers generally receive higher scores.
Consider, for example, the inside spread measurement. This measurement, representing the widest point between the main beams, often contributes significantly to the final score. A wider spread generally correlates with a higher score, reflecting the overall size and potential genetic superiority of the deer. Similarly, the length of the main beams, measured from the base to the tip, plays a crucial role. Longer main beams generally indicate older and potentially more robust individuals. Boone and Crockett Club Scoring System
The Boone and Crockett Club system, renowned for its rigor and historical significance, emphasizes symmetry and typical antler conformation. It assigns specific values to measurements like main beam length, tine length, and circumference. A complex formula incorporating these values generates a final score, used for official record-keeping and recognition of exceptional trophies. This system provides a benchmark for evaluating trophy whitetails, influencing hunting practices and management strategies.
-
Pope and Young Club Scoring System
The Pope and Young Club scoring system, specifically designed for bow-hunted deer, mirrors the Boone and Crockett system in its methodology but maintains separate records. It employs similar measurements and calculations but recognizes only antlers taken with archery equipment. This distinction acknowledges the unique challenges of bowhunting and provides a dedicated platform for recognizing exceptional bowhunting trophies.
-
Non-Typical Antlers
Both Boone and Crockett and Pope and Young systems account for non-typical antler formations, recognizing that genetic variations or injuries can result in unusual growth patterns. These systems incorporate additional measurements and calculations for non-typical points and configurations, ensuring a fair evaluation of these unique antlers. 4. Boone and Crockett Club
The Boone and Crockett Club plays a pivotal role in the context of scoring deer antlers, serving as a primary authority on standardized measurement and record-keeping. Established in 1887, the Club’s influence extends beyond simply maintaining records of exceptional trophies. Its scoring system, meticulously developed and refined over decades, provides the foundation for many online score deer antlers calculators. This system, based on precise measurements of various antler features, provides a consistent and objective framework for evaluating antler size and configuration. The Club’s emphasis on fair chase hunting ethics further reinforces the importance of responsible hunting practices, intertwining conservation principles with the pursuit of trophy animals. For instance, the Club’s scoring system doesn’t simply reward large antlers; it considers symmetry and typical conformation, promoting appreciation for the natural aesthetics of antler development.

7. Wildlife Management Implications
Antler size data, often collected and analyzed using tools like “score deer antlers calculators,” offers valuable insights for wildlife management. Antler development reflects various factors influencing deer populations, including habitat quality, nutrition, age structure, and genetics. Consistent declines in average antler scores within a specific region could signal habitat degradation, prompting interventions like habitat restoration or prescribed burns. Conversely, significant increases might suggest overpopulation, potentially necessitating adjustments to hunting regulations. The relationship between antler characteristics and overall herd health provides managers with a quantifiable metric for assessing the effectiveness of management strategies. For instance, monitoring antler size in areas implementing specific management practices, such as prescribed burning or supplemental feeding, allows for evaluation of those practices’ impact on herd health and antler development. This data-driven approach enables adaptive management, allowing adjustments based on observed outcomes.

Question 2: What is the difference between gross and net scores in antler scoring?
Gross score represents the total sum of all antler measurements, while net score subtracts deductions for asymmetry between matching points. Net score provides a more accurate representation of a trophy’s symmetry and is often used for official record-keeping purposes.
